Brueck Brubeck women's boxing shorts, black L size (BX11150)
LProduct details
Material:
- 53% Polyamide
- 43% Polypropylene
- 4% Elastane
2-Layer Construction:
- Inner layer wicks moisture away, leaving skin dry
- Outer layer provides good thermal insulation, retains optimal body heat, and protects against cooling
Functions:
- Prevents overheating
- Quick-drying
- Easy care
